The 10 chemicals with the highest cumulative on-site releases in pounds (lbs) across all available years.
Rows are years. Columns show the five highest-total chemicals across all years plus each year's total release volume.
| All values in pounds (lbs) | ||||||
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Year | 1,1,1-Trichloroethane | Sulfuric acid (acid aerosols including mists, vapors, gas, fog, and other airborne forms of any particle size) | Tetrachloroethylene | Nickel | Hydrochloric acid (acid aerosols including mists, vapors, gas, fog, and other airborne forms of any particle size) | Total (lbs) |
| 1996 | — | — | — | — | — | 20 |
| 1994 | — | 340 | — | — | — | 340 |
| 1992 | — | 924 | — | 1,648 | — | 2,572 |
| 1991 | 26,866 | 4,655 | — | 1,277 | — | 32,798 |
| 1990 | 17,402 | 19,500 | — | — | 1,002 | 37,904 |
| 1989 | 5,758 | 15 | 12,309 | — | — | 18,082 |
| 1988 | — | 15 | — | — | — | 15 |
▎ Facilities report to EPA's TRI once they manufacture, process, or use a listed chemical above set thresholds. Once that threshold is crossed, they must report actual releases regardless of size — so a small number reflects genuine low-level discharge, not a data error.
